Cutting meat from your diet does not automatically make you a vegan. The two basic rules of starting a vegan diet are cutting out meat and other animal products. So, in addition to avoiding meat, you also have to keep away from products like cheese, eggs, honey, and milk.

Oatmeal is a standard breakfast food option in most households. It is loved due to its enriched flavors and numerous health benefits. Consuming oatmeal can help with the following (7):
Oatmeal contains specific antioxidants known as polyphenols, which contain plant-based compounds known as avenanthramides. These compounds can help improve your blood flow, reduce your blood pressure and reduce inflammation.
If you have type 2 diabetes, then you may want to add oatmeal to your diet plan. It contains beta-glucan, a soluble fiber that improves how insulin responds in your body. It can also help you manage your sugar levels, so long as you don’t add sugar to your dish of oatmeal.
Oatmeal is rich in various minerals and vitamins like zinc, phosphorus, folate, magnesium, iron, Vitamin B-1, copper, and Vitamin B-5. All these vitamins and nutrients help your body perform various functions.
Oatmeal contains soluble fiber that satiates you quickly and for a longer duration. Consequently, it helps you limit how much and how often you eat. This might explain why oatmeal is among the best weight loss breakfast options.
There are different oatmeal varieties you can choose to purchase. They include the steel-cut variety, oat groats, rolled, and the crushed variety. Regardless of the variety you pick, you will end up reaping the same benefits by eating oatmeal.

The next healthy vegan breakfast idea you can have this morning is a bagel and a hot beverage (5). You can choose to buy or prepare your vegan beverage. If you choose to buy it, then remember to pick the drink option prepared from almond, soy, or coconut milk.
The same applies to your bagels. If you choose to buy them, remember to ask for the vegan option. If you can find a whole-grain vegan bagel, that is even better. You will find that instead of having cream cheese, your bagel might, for example, have an avocado spread.
You can still enjoy a scramble, even if it is not prepared from eggs. In this case, you will replace the eggs with tofu. You will also need leafy green vegetables such as spinach and kale, and/or broccoli to make this vegan scramble.
Since this meal contains fewer calories, it is a great breakfast idea weight watchers can try.
If you are craving some toast, then go ahead and buy some whole-grain toast. It is rich in fiber that helps in preventing several digestive complications such as constipation. If you want more flavor on your toast, go ahead and spread either almond or peanut butter on it (8).
You can then prepare some hot chocolate or tea using plant-based milk and have it alongside your whole-grain toast.
The next way you can enjoy your whole wheat bread is by preparing an avocado toast. Please search for a ripe avocado and spread it on your bread. You can enrich the flavor of this toast by adding a pinch of salt and some lemon juice or some cherry tomatoes.
The other vegan breakfast idea you can try is some whole-grain cereal with either almond or soy milk. This simple meal idea will provide you with enough energy to see you through your day’s activities.

If you want to start and maintain a healthy vegan breakfast every morning, then here are some tips for you:
If you are guessing that your morning will be hectic, prepare your breakfast the night before. For example, you can prepare a vegan bagel or burger and pack it to go. As such, you are sure you will not skip breakfast or spend time figuring out what you will eat.
Again, set out the ingredients you will use the night before (4). For example, if you will make oatmeal porridge using steel-cut oats, soak them the night before. Remember that they take a tremendous amount of time before they cook, which can discourage you from cooking breakfast. You can also make overnight oats that cook while you sleep and are ready for you when you wake up.
